St Aidan's Church is an Anglican church in , a village in , in England. A church was built in Gillamoor in the 12th century. In 1802, it was entirely rebuilt by the local stonemason James Smith, using stone from a redundant church in . is situated 1¼ miles north of High Park Farm.
